CONSTRUCTION

Construction has been an integrated part of Parsons services since its first construction program of a grassroots design-build refinery in Turkey in 1952. From the ice fields of Prudhoe Bay, Alaska, to the Yanbu Industrial City in the desert of Saudi Arabia, from refineries to missile test facilities and environmental cleanup programs, Parsons provides full-service construction capabilities in conjunction with engineering operations worldwide. Services and staff are available for union or merit shop programs and for direct-hire on union-only basis. Construction management resources include:

  • Supervisory and nonsupervisory field administrative staff
  • Field construction engineering
  • Inspection personnel

Parsons construction staff maintains union agreements and provides labor relations experience for the negotiation of contracts and ongoing activities.
